Default Another overheating xj

I cant turn off full heat.My xj runs at 225 at 55mph then when i slow to 30-45 down the temps drop to 215. at idle it runs at 210. the e fan is wired to a switch which i always turn on. I just installed a new Flowkool water pump and Robertshaw thermostat (195). When i turn off full heat the temps jump into the red. Usually i then crank the heat and pull over immediately the temperature drops back to 225. I have a full aluminum rad 3 row coming in the mail. I have not flushed the system. I really want to get the temperature to 195 heat off for wheeling this summer. The fan clutch seems to work good.

The rad is the heart of the cooling system......the new one, along with the other new components, will likely solve any overheat issues. Running 195 this summer while wheeling probably ain't going to happen but it shouldn't overheat. Don't guess about a fan clutch, spend $35 for a new one.

Do plenty of research/homework before modding the OE factory rad fan setup. The last thing u want to do is wind up with less CFM air flow than stock. The OE fans r not the weak link in the cooling system.......it's the dinky rad.
